What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ing describes making use of 2 panes of glass in a window system, separated by an air or gas-filled area. This develops an efficient thermal barrier, minimizing heat transfer and contributing to lower energy bills. The spaces between the panes can be filled with inert gases such as argon or krypton, further improving insulation.

Benefits of Double Glazing
- Energy Efficiency: Reduces heat loss, resulting in lower heating costs.
- Noise Reduction: Provides sound insulation by lessening external noise.
- Enhanced Security: Tougher to break compared to single glazing.
- UV Protection: Blocks hazardous ultraviolet rays, protecting home furnishings from fading.
- Improved Comfort: Maintains a constant indoor temperature level.
Key Considerations Before Installation
Prior to installing double glazing, several factors need to be considered:
- Type of Glass: Choose from choices like low-emissivity glass (low-E), laminated glass, or toughened glass depending upon the property's requirements.
- Frame Material: Common choices include wood, aluminum, and uPVC, each with its own benefits and disadvantages.
- Regulations: Familiarize yourself with regional building regulations and guidelines concerning window installations.
- Budget: Determine your budget plan, as double glazing can differ significantly in rate.

The Installation Process
Installing double glazing is a task that can either be carried out by expert installers or DIY enthusiasts with the best abilities. The list below steps lay out the installation process:
1. Preparation
- Measure the Windows: Accurate measurements of existing windows are necessary for purchasing the proper size of double-glazed systems.
- Pick a Style: Decide on window styles, such as casement, sash, or tilt-and-turn.
2. Buying the Double Glazed Units
As soon as the measurements are taken, it is time to purchase the double-glazed units. Make sure to choose the kind of glass, frame product, and any extra functions, such as gas filling or low-E coverings.
3. Removal of Old Windows
- Thoroughly eliminate the existing window systems by loosening up frames and taking them out, guaranteeing minimal damage to the surrounding locations.
4. Installing the New Double Glazed Units
- Place the Frame: Insert the brand-new double-glazed frame into the opening and check for level and plumb.
- Seal the Unit: Apply sealant around the frames to make sure an airtight fit, further improving insulation.
- Protect the Frame: Fix the frame in place using screws or brackets, guaranteeing it's safe.
- Ending up Touches: Install trims and finishes to finish the appearance, making sure all spaces are sealed.
5. Checking
Lastly, test the operation of any movable parts, ensure they open and close efficiently, and inspect for any drafts or leakages.
6. Tidying up
Dispose of the old window units and tidy the work location. Once done, the new setup must be ready for use.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does it take to install double glazing?
The timeline differs depending on the number and size of windows being replaced, however typically it can vary from a few hours for a single window to a number of days for multiple installations.
Q2: Is double glazing worth the financial investment?
Yes, while the initial expense is higher than single glazing, the long-term cost savings on energy expenses and convenience levels make it a beneficial financial investment.
Q3: Do I need preparing consent for double glazing?
This depends upon your area and the type of home. In heritage-listed locations or conservation zones, special approvals may be needed.
Q4: Can I install double glazing myself?
If you have the necessary abilities and tools, it is possible to install double glazing yourself. However, hiring a professional is typically advised to ensure quality setup and compliance with regulations.

Q5: How can I preserve double-glazed windows?
Routinely clean the glass and frames with gentle household cleaners. Inspect the seals occasionally for wear and change them when necessary.
